The 2016 session of the General Assembly adjourned on July 1, 2016. The following is a list of bills related to planning, land use regulation, environment, transportation, and similar matters addressed in 2016.

House bills are listed first, followed by Senate bills. The last action taken in each house is indicated. For bills that have become law, a session law chapter number is included in the last column. Abbreviations used in the table are:

  • "Comm. fav." indicates the bill was reported out of a committee with a favorable recommendation, but no floor action was taken.
  • "Passed" indicates the bill passed third reading in the indicated house.
  • "Conf." indicates a conference committee was appointed to reconcile differences in House and Senate versions of adopted bills, but no conference report was adopted.
  • "Ratif." indicates final General Assembly approval, pending action by Governor. The Governor has until July 31 to sign or veto pending bills.
  • "S.L. 2016-xx" is the session law number for bills that have become law.
